Roto Frank of America, Inc. Wins Manufacturer of the Year Award

Date: 25 October 2019

On Wednesday, October 23, 2019 Roto Frank of America, Inc. won the Manufacturer of the Year Award from the Middlesex Chamber of Commerce, Connecticut’s largest Chamber, during their annual Business Awards Ceremony.

The award was presented to Roto North America’s President and CEO, Chris Dimou, along with numerous Roto employees from MCC’s President, Larry McHugh.

The award honored Roto’s 40 years of manufacturing in Connecticut, along with the expansion of numerous innovative products throughout the company’s history.

Dimou said, “We are deeply honored by this prestigious award. I would like to sincerely express our gratitude to the Middlesex Chamber of Commerce and their leadership for our great collaboration. I would also like to especially thank our loyal, dedicated and hard-working staff. Without them it would not have been possible to achieve the longevity of the company and the extraordinary growth we have been experiencing over the last decade.”
